Location and Transportation

Merida Uxmal and Cacao Plantation Day Trip - Location and Transportation

The meeting point for the Merida Uxmal and Cacao Plantation Day Trip is the lobby of a Cancun hotel at 6:00 AM. Travelers will embark on a comfortable, air-conditioned minivan for a 4-hour drive to Uxmal. The trip includes a visit to a cacao plantation and a traditional Yucatan hacienda, offering a unique insight into the local culture. Explorers will also have the opportunity to tour Merida, the vibrant capital of the Yucatan peninsula. The tour concludes around 7:30 PM back at the Cancun hotel, providing a full day of exploration and learning. Is There a Dress Code or Any Specific Clothing Recommendations for Visiting the Archaeological Sites and Cacao Plantation?

For exploring archaeological sites and visiting a cacao plantation, there is no specific dress code, but it is recommended to wear comfortable clothing, closed-toe shoes, a hat, sunglasses, and sunscreen for a pleasant experience.
